About This Piece

Vintage Design

Stylish organic armchair designed by Louis van Teeffelen for wébé, 1960.

Armchair made of Afromosia wood, upholstered with the original color and leather type. The beautifully designed frame is made of rosewood.

The armchair has a very comfortable seat.

The chair is in good vintage condition.

Designer: Louis van Teeffelen

Manufacturer: Wébé

Origin: the Netherlands

Period: 1960

Dimensions:

Seat height: 38 cm

Height: 82cm

Width: 61 cm

Depth: 80 cmCondition: Very good, signs of wear by age

About the Creator

Louis van Teeffelen

Aloysius (Louis) Allegonda van Teeffelen (1921-1972) was a Dutch industrial designer credited with contributing to the midcentury modern design movement in the Netherlands, and is most well-known for his work with the Dutch furniture manufacturer WéBé.

Biographical information on van Teeffelen is scarce but our editors have ascertained that he was born in in 1921 in the former municipality of Leeuwen, which is located in the province of Gelderland in the Netherlands. Sources state that van Teeffelen became Wébé’s head designer in 1955, but we have little knowledge on his educational background.

As head designer for Wébé, which was located in his hometown, van Teeffelen introduced a classic midcentury Scandinavian aesthetic (which has lead to many mistaking van Teeffelen for a Dane) and a number of popular designs to the Dutch market. Cabinets, desks and tables with anthropomorphic, “smiling” handles along with sculptural structures became van Teeffelen’s signature. His most well-known work is the Pelican Armchair (1960s)—characterized by its beautifully organic and teak form, it is a true Dutch design classic. Not to be confused with Danish designer Finn Juhl’s Pelican Chair (1939), van Teeffelen’s gracefully curved scissor-like legs calls to mind the legs of a pelican, while the arm rests mimic the bird’s beak.

His other work for Wébé includes the Cow Horn Chair (1950s); Scissor Chair (1950s); Easy Chair (circa 1960); an wide array of teak dining tables, coffee tables, sideboards, and desks; and various modular wall systems that feature teak shelves and cabinets. Many credenzas and small cabinets feature ceramic tiles decorating the doors, designed by Dutch ceramist Jaap Ravelli.

Van Teeffelen, who left the company in 1967, was the most significant and successful designer in WéBé’s history. Although WéBé is no longer in business, van Teeffelen’s designs are considered excellent examples of mid-century modern design and are highly sought-after by collectors today.

It is speculated that van Teeffelen also designed products—mainly his signature teak modular wall systems, secretaries and desks—for the Dutch furniture brand Topform around the same time he was designing for Wébé. Our editors are working hard to confirm this story.

Van Teeffelen passed away in his hometown in 1972, at the age of 51.

About the Maker

WéBé

Dutch furniture manufacturer WéBé was founded in 1938 in Benden-Leeuwen (near Tiel). Originally called Walraven and Bevers after its two founders, the company’s name was later shortened to the abbreviated WéBé.

The company had a slow start, but in the 1950s and ’60s it gained major recognition and expanded to become one of the largest furniture producers in the Netherlands. This success had a lot to do with Dutch designer Louis van Teeffelen (1921-1972), who became Wébé’s head designer in 1955. Van Teeffelen introduced a classic midcentury Scandinavian aesthetic and a number of popular designs in a similar style to the work of his contemporary, Poul Cadovius (1911-2011). Casegoods and tables with anthropomorphic, “smiling” handles along with sculptural structures became van Teeffelen’s signature. His work for Wébé includes the Cow Horn Chair (1950s); Scissor Chair (1950s); Pelican Armchair (1960s); Easy Chair (1960s); an array of teak dining tables, coffee tables, sideboards, and desks; and various modular wall systems that feature teak shelves and cabinets.

Van Teeffelen, who left the company in 1967, turned out to be the only significant and well-received designer in WéBé’s history. In the 1970s, the company hit rough times, not only suffering van Teeffelen’s loss but also meeting with increased competition from new low-cost, mass-produced furniture companies. In the 1990s, Wébé ceased manufacturing all together and closed its doors for good. Although the company is no longer in business, van Teeffelen’s designs are considered excellent examples of the midcentury modern movement and are highly sought-after by collectors today.
